Yelp is so fantastic. In addition to reviews, there are often photos. If you see a review that you want more info on, either positive or negative, you can hit up the writer and they are usually really helpful. After narrowing down reviews on Yelp, Google and Foursquare, it's a good idea to check both the webpage, IG, Twitter, Facebook, etc. for photos of their work. I'd also read through the comments.
